Job description

Raleigh Ophthalmology is a busy well-established, progressive twelve physician group with subspecialty care in cornea, glaucoma, oculoplastics, pediatrics, and comprehensive eye care services. We have a robust practice, with three area office locations and dozens of bright, qualified employees who help us deliver the best service and patient care in our medical specialty.

Our employees are an integral part of the experience at Raleigh Ophthalmology. Not only are we committed to serving our patients, but we also have a culture of servant leadership and collaboration that supports each team member’s personal and professional development.

Responsible for assisting the ophthalmologist and optometrists by gathering data pertaining to the patient’s ocular health status. The ophthalmic technician is proficient in performing appropriate clinical tests, drawing on formal education and/or clinical experience that provide a solid understanding of the theory and principles of eye care.

Clinical
  • Reviews patient chart to ensure completeness and accuracy of information.
  • Perform testing ordered by doctor and determined by the type of exam scheduled, patient complaint and/or patient history.
  • Ability to act as a medical scribe while physician examines patient, entering data into electronic medical records
  • Takes an ocular and systemic history and accurately records visual acuity.
  • Administers topical ophthalmic or oral medications under the direction of the physician.
  • Ability to assist with simple in-office procedures ensures proper informed consent is obtained.
  • Assists with patient education.
  • Maintains cleanliness and orderliness of exam rooms during the workday.
  • Complies with all practice procedures and protocols. Complies with all State and Federal regulations.
